Tech body slams telcos for enterprise messaging stance
Broadband India Forum (BIF), a lobby for tech companies, has slammed the telcos’ stand against the use of OTT platforms such as WhatsApp, for enterprise communications, saying operators are only trying to thrust a technologically inferior and user-unfriendly product like SMS through regulatory/administrative intervention. The Broadband India Forum (BIF) said the SMS route is often unreliable due to lapses in network coverage, which is why telco customers prefer app-based messaging platforms like WhatsApp over SMS. “The telcos’ action is analogous to insisting on transportation by bullock cart when modern and more affordable automotive transportation is available and permitted,” T V Ramachandran, president, BIF, told ET. The tech forum counts Amazon, Meta (which owns WhatsApp), Microsoft, Intel, Qualcomm, and Google among its key members. The BIF president added that WhatsApp and Telegram are perfectly legal and permissible products and it’s absurd to allege that some corporates are circumventing and bypassing the legal telecom route by using apps. The popularity of OTT communication platforms among users, he said, is the result of better experience.

Beyonce's 'RENAISSANCE' Film: Trailer dropped. Know about premiere date, trailer, everything in detail
Beyonce released the trailer of her film 'RENAISSANCE: A Film by Beyonce' on Thursday, November 9. It promises to capture the eye-popping global tour of the same name in all its silver-streaked glory. Directed by Beyonce, the movie will hit theaters around the world on December 1 after its Los Angeles premiere on November 25 and a London premiere on November 30. The tickets are available to purchase now. The RENAISSANCE film will air on Thursdays, Fridays, Saturdays and Sundays with multiple showtimes on each day.

Iran rejects G7 calls to stop supporting Hamas
Iran on Thursday rejected a G7 statement which called on Tehran to stop supporting Hamas militants and taking actions that «destabilise» the Middle East. Tehran's comment came a day after foreign ministers from the G7 group of advanced economies, meeting in Tokyo, expressed support for «humanitarian pauses and corridors» in the Israeli-Hamas war. Israeli air strikes have pounded the Palestinian territory of Gaza since Hamas gunmen stormed across the heavily militarised border on October 7 to kill more than 1,400 people, most of them civilians, and seize around 240 hostages, according to Israeli officials. The subsequent Israeli bombing campaign in Gaza has killed more than 10,500 people, two-thirds of them women and children, according to the Hamas-run health ministry. The G7 also called on Iran to «refrain from providing support for Hamas and taking further actions that destabilise the Middle East, including support for Lebanese Hezbollah and other non-state actors.» On Thursday, Iran's foreign ministry spokesman Nasser Kanani «strongly condemned» the statement by the group which includes the United States, Britain, Germany, Canada, Italy, France, and Japan. He said Iran has engaged in «non-stop efforts to stop military attacks of the Zionist aggressor regime (Israel) on the defenceless citizens» in Gaza.

Assam Police arrests Congress MLA for making derogatory statements against priests
Assam Police has arrested Congress MLA Aftabuddin Mollah for allegedly making derogatory remarks about the priests. Police arrested Mollah in Guwahati Tuesday night for making derogatory remarks on temples and namghars (prayer places) during a public rally at Goalpara on November 4. Assam's Special DGP Harmeet Singh said, “A complaint was filed and accordingly police found it cognizable as per the law and he was arrested and produced before the court.” Mollah said that in criminal activities priests and saints are involved. Several FIRs were filed against the MLA after his remarks went viral on social media, Mollah issued an apology, and the Congress party issued a show cause notice.

How to buy Gold coins, bars online from MMTC-PAMP website this Dhanteras
gold and silver on Dhanteras day. This time Dhanteras is on November 10, 2023, i.e., tomorrow. If you want to avoid the crowds in a jeweller shop, then there is an option to buy gold coins and bars online. One can buy gold coins, bars online from MMTC-PAMP, reputed branded jewellers such as Tanishq, Malabar Gold & Diamonds etc. MMTC-PAMP is a joint venture between the Government of India-owned Metals and Minerals Trading Corporation of India (MMTC) and Switzerland-based gold refining company, Produits Artistiques Métaux Précieux (PAMP). MMTC-PAMP sells gold and silver coins and bars only through their offline and online stores. One cannot buy gold and silver jewellery from MMTC-PAMP. The products sold by MMTC-PAMP have received accreditation from the London Bullion Market Association (LBMA). «Since Diwali is dedicated to the worship of Goddess Lakshmi while Dhanteras marks the beginning of the five-day Diwali celebrations, buying pure gold and silver on Dhanteras holds specific significance. At MMTC-PAMP, we offer the purest 999.99+ Gold (24K) and silver products, seamlessly blending the finest Switzerland technological craftsmanship with Indian traditional values and customisation,» says Vikas Singh, MD & CEO, MMTC-PAMP.

Adani Ports Q2 Results: Net profit rises 4% YoY to Rs 1,748 crore; revenue jumps 28%
Revenue from operations during the second quarter increased 28% year-on-year (YoY) to Rs 6,646 crore. It was Rs 5,211 crore in the in the last year quarter. EBITDA for the quarter (excluding the forex loss) jumped 19% YoY to Rs 3,880 crore in the July-September period. The domestic cargo volumes of the company jumped 13% YoY to 98.12 mmt, while the total cargo volumes rose 17% YoY to 101.22 mmt in the reporting quarter. Mundra Port handled cargo volumes to the tune of 44.44 mmt in the September quarter, up 14% YoY.

Uttar Pradesh's air quality deteriorates to 'very poor' category
Air Quality Index (AQI) in Uttar Pradesh deteriorated from the 'poor' category to the 'very poor' category on Thursday, as per the data from the Central Pollution Control Board (CPCB). In view of the worsening air quality index, the Noida and Ghaziabad district administrations on Tuesday decided to discontinue all physical classes in schools apart from those for students of Class X and XII until Friday, in view of the worsening air quality conditions. The administration suggested that schools conduct classes in online mode. Meanwhile, the neighbouring Delhi government on Monday decided to reintroduce the odd-even rule from November 13 to 20 in view of concerns about deterioration in air quality. A decision on further extending the odd-even rule would be taken later. According to the 8-point action plan, there will be a ban on entry of truck traffic into Delhi (except for trucks carrying essential commodities/ providing essential services and all LNG/ CNG/ electric trucks). The Supreme Court on Tuesday expressed grave concern over the hazardous air quality in the national capital and directed that farmers should stop stubble burning forthwith in Punjab, Haryana, and western Uttar Pradesh, saying it was one of the major contributors to air pollution. Air pollution levels can be high during the winter months for a number of reasons, including dust and vehicular pollution, dry-cold weather, stubble burning, burning crop residues after the harvest season, and commuting.
